When you bring your tire into a repair shop it will be demounted and thoroughly inspected. If it’s a simple puncture to the center of the tread area, the nail will be removed and the hole repaired using a plug/patch combination. The repair shop will plug the hole from the outside and patch it from the inside of the tire. Witryna26 paź 2008 · Nails and such don't "blow" tires like a party balloon, they allow air to escape and eventually flatten them. (Nails in the sidewall, where there is a lot of flexing can cause the tire to warp, heat up, and possibly fail. Never repair a puncture in the sidewall.)
